Isham [Isum], John


(b c1680; d London, bur. 12 June 1726). English organist and composer. He served for some years as deputy organist for William Croft in London, and on 22 January 1711 was elected organist of St Anne’s, Soho, on Croft’s resignation. In July 1713 he graduated BMus at Oxford, and on 3 April 1718, in succession to Maurice Greene, he was elected organist of St Andrew’s, Holborn, with a stipend of £50 per annum, upon which he resigned his place at St Anne’s. Shortly afterwards he was chosen organist of St Margaret’s, Westminster, a post he held in conjunction with that at St Andrew’s until his death. In 1706 he and William Morley (who was also to take an Oxford BMus in 1713) published A Collection of New Songs (six of which are by Isham). One two-part song, Bury delights my roving eye, became so popular it was included by Hawkins in his History. Isham wrote at least ten other songs, which were published singly. The words of two anthems (O sing unto the Lord and Unto thee, O Lord) are included in Divine Harmony (London, 1712), the first Chapel Royal wordbook. His most substantial work is the ode O tuneful God and all ye Sacred Nine, which, though not actually identified as such, must have been his BMus exercise (score and parts in GB-Ob). A recently discovered receipt shows that, while organist of St Margaret's, he also copied music for Westminster Abbey.

Ishchenko, Yury Yakovlevich


(b Kherson, 5 May 1938). Ukrainian composer. He graduated from Shtoharenko's class in the Kiev Conservatory (1960), and also undertook postgraduate work with him (1961–4). From 1964 he taught in the department of composition at the conservatory (from 1981 as senior lecturer and from 1991 as professor), lecturing on orchestration, the study of musical instruments, and taking composition classes. His students include the Ukrainian composers Zagaykevych, Ovcharenko and Runchak in addition to composers from Abkhazia, Lebanon, Mongolia, Russia and Vietnam. In 1969 he was a laureate of the All-Union young composers' competition, then in 1977 he defended his dissertation for the degree of Candidate of Science on the subject of the dramatic use of timbre in the symphonies of Lyatoshyns'ky. In 1991 he was awarded the title of Honoured Representative of the Arts of Ukraine. His work is broad and varied in terms of themes and genres; it leans on the traditions of Lyatoshyns'ky, Revuts'ky and Shostakovich.
